Transaction 4106a387f80595dacf962fc8afa5627fefc14e91d50a3a185d32d9a763e0de54
1 Input
1 Output
-
4106a387f80595dacf962fc8afa5627fefc14e91d50a3a185d32d9a763e0de54:0
- value
- 30842209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c6ed1d4b88db5da73ee12f9e6b968ef28ab7f88 OP_EQUAL
- address
- 3EVZHHT5FobbC1wsoKyhfz6YLUNUcXeCeG